mysql用的是什么数据库
-
MySQL是一种关系型数据库管理系统(RDBMS),它使用的是自己独有的数据库引擎,称为InnoDB引擎。MySQL是一种开源的数据库系统,被广泛应用于各种规模的应用程序中。
以下是关于MySQL数据库的几个特点和功能:
-
数据库管理:MySQL可以用于创建、管理和操作数据库。它支持创建多个数据库,并提供了一组强大的管理命令和工具,用于管理数据库的结构和内容。
-
数据存储和检索:MySQL使用表格的形式来存储数据,并提供了一套强大的查询语言(SQL)来检索和操作数据。通过SQL语句,用户可以轻松地执行各种查询、插入、更新和删除操作。
-
多用户支持:MySQL支持多用户访问数据库,可以设置不同的用户权限和角色,以控制对数据库的访问和操作。这使得多个用户可以同时使用数据库,而不会相互干扰。
-
可扩展性:MySQL支持高度可扩展的架构,可以轻松地处理大量的数据和用户请求。它支持分布式架构和集群配置,可以在需要时进行水平和垂直扩展。
-
安全性:MySQL提供了一套完整的安全机制来保护数据库的机密性和完整性。它支持用户身份验证、访问控制和数据加密等功能,以确保只有授权用户才能访问和修改数据库。
总结起来,MySQL是一种功能强大、可靠性高、性能优越的数据库管理系统,它被广泛应用于各种类型的应用程序中,包括网站、企业级应用、移动应用等。它的开源性质和丰富的功能使得它成为了许多开发者和组织的首选数据库。
1年前 -
-
MySQL是一种开源的关系型数据库管理系统(RDBMS),它使用了一种称为结构化查询语言(SQL)的标准语言来管理和操作数据库。MySQL是由瑞典MySQL AB公司开发的,现在属于Oracle公司所有。MySQL是一种轻量级的数据库,它具有高性能、高可靠性和可扩展性的特点,被广泛应用于各种Web应用程序和互联网应用。MySQL支持多种操作系统,包括Windows、Linux、Unix等,同时也支持多种编程语言的接口,如PHP、Python、Java等。MySQL提供了丰富的功能和工具,包括数据存储、数据查询、事务处理、数据安全等,使得开发人员可以方便地管理和操作数据库。总之,MySQL是一种强大且广泛使用的数据库管理系统,它为开发人员提供了灵活、高效的数据库解决方案。
1年前 -
MySQL使用的是关系型数据库。关系型数据库是一种使用表格来存储和管理数据的数据库管理系统。在关系型数据库中,数据被组织为一系列表格,每个表格由行和列组成。每一行代表一个记录,每一列代表一个字段。
MySQL是一种开源的关系型数据库管理系统,由瑞典MySQL AB公司开发,后被Oracle收购。MySQL以其高性能、可靠性和易用性而闻名,广泛应用于各种规模的应用程序和网站。
下面将从方法、操作流程等方面讲解如何使用MySQL数据库。
-
安装MySQL数据库
- 下载MySQL安装包,可以从MySQL官方网站下载适合自己操作系统的安装包。
- 运行安装程序,按照提示进行安装。可以选择自定义安装选项,例如选择安装路径、配置端口等。
- 安装完成后,启动MySQL服务。
-
连接到MySQL数据库
- 打开命令行终端或者MySQL客户端工具。
- 输入连接命令,格式为:mysql -u 用户名 -p 密码 -h 主机名 -P 端口号。
例如:mysql -u root -p 123456 -h localhost -P 3306。 - 输入正确的连接信息后,按下Enter键,即可连接到MySQL数据库。
-
创建数据库
- 连接到MySQL数据库后,可以使用以下命令创建数据库:
CREATE DATABASE 数据库名; - 示例:CREATE DATABASE mydatabase;
- 数据库创建完成后,可以使用以下命令切换到该数据库:
USE 数据库名; - 示例:USE mydatabase;
- 连接到MySQL数据库后,可以使用以下命令创建数据库:
-
创建表格
- 连接到指定的数据库后,可以使用以下命令创建表格:
CREATE TABLE 表名 (
列名1 数据类型,
列名2 数据类型,
…
); - 示例:C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
gender VARCHAR(10)
);
- 连接到指定的数据库后,可以使用以下命令创建表格:
-
插入数据
- 使用INSERT INTO语句将数据插入到表格中:
INSERT INTO 表名 (列1, 列2, …) VALUES (值1, 值2, …); - 示例:INSERT INTO students (id, name, age, gender) VALUES (1, 'Alice', 18, 'Female');
- 使用INSERT INTO语句将数据插入到表格中:
-
查询数据
- 使用SELECT语句从表格中查询数据:
SELECT 列1, 列2, … FROM 表名 WHERE 条件; - 示例:SELECT * FROM students WHERE gender = 'Female';
- 使用SELECT语句从表格中查询数据:
-
更新数据
- 使用UPDATE语句更新表格中的数据:
UPDATE 表名 SET 列1 = 值1, 列2 = 值2 WHERE 条件; - 示例:UPDATE students SET age = 19 WHERE id = 1;
- 使用UPDATE语句更新表格中的数据:
-
删除数据
- 使用DELETE语句删除表格中的数据:
DELETE FROM 表名 WHERE 条件; - 示例:DELETE FROM students WHERE age > 20;
- 使用DELETE语句删除表格中的数据:
以上是MySQL数据库的基本使用方法和操作流程。MySQL还提供了更多的功能和命令,如索引、视图、事务等,可以根据具体的需求进行学习和应用。
1年前 -